What Is the Natural Texture of Granite Countertops?

- Natural Variations: Granite is formed from molten rock that cools and solidifies over millions of years. This process results in a unique blend of minerals, including quartz, feldspar, and mica, which create the stone’s distinctive patterns and colors. Because granite is a natural material, each slab has its own variations in texture and appearance. These natural variations contribute to the uniqueness and beauty of granite countertops.
- Polished Finish: Most homeowners prefer a polished finish for their granite countertops, which enhances the stone’s color and pattern while providing a smooth and glossy surface. The polishing process involves grinding the granite with abrasive pads until it reaches a high shine. While polished granite is smooth to the touch, it may still have some minor pits and fissures, which are natural characteristics of the stone. These imperfections are usually not noticeable and do not affect the countertop’s functionality.
- Honed Finish: A honed finish provides a matte or satin look, offering a smooth but less glossy surface compared to polished granite. Honed granite is achieved by stopping the polishing process before the stone reaches a high shine. This finish is popular for its contemporary appearance and ability to hide scratches and fingerprints better than a polished finish. However, honed granite can be more susceptible to staining and may require more frequent sealing.
- Leathered Finish: A leathered finish adds texture to the granite surface, creating a unique, tactile feel. This finish is achieved by brushing the granite with diamond-tipped brushes, which enhances the stone’s natural texture and creates a non-reflective, slightly rough surface. Leathered granite is known for its durability and ability to hide fingerprints and water spots. It provides a rustic and sophisticated look, making it a popular choice for certain design styles.
Should Granite Countertops Have a Completely Smooth Surface?
The expectation of a completely smooth surface for granite countertops can be influenced by several factors, including personal preference and the intended use of the countertops. Here’s what to consider about the smoothness of granite countertops.
- Functional Considerations: A smooth surface can be beneficial for certain kitchen tasks, such as rolling out dough or working with delicate ingredients. A polished granite countertop provides a smooth, even surface that is ideal for these activities. However, minor natural imperfections, such as small pits or fissures, are common in granite and do not typically impact its functionality. These imperfections can be filled with resin during the polishing process, resulting in a smoother surface.
- Aesthetic Preferences: Some homeowners prefer the look and feel of a perfectly smooth countertop, while others appreciate the natural texture and character of granite. The choice between a polished, honed, or leathered finish can influence the smoothness of the surface. Each finish offers a different level of smoothness and texture, allowing homeowners to select the one that best matches their aesthetic preferences and design style.
- Durability and Maintenance: The finish and smoothness of granite countertops can also affect their durability and maintenance requirements. Polished granite is highly resistant to stains and moisture due to its smooth, sealed surface. Honed and leathered finishes, while visually appealing, may require more frequent sealing to maintain their resistance to stains. The slight texture of honed or leathered granite can also make cleaning more challenging, as debris can become trapped in the surface texture.
- Natural Characteristics: It’s important to recognize that granite is a natural stone, and its inherent characteristics include variations in texture and appearance. While a completely smooth surface may be desirable for some, embracing the natural imperfections of granite can add to its unique charm and beauty. These natural characteristics are what make each granite countertop one-of-a-kind.

- Regular Maintenance: Maintain the smoothness and appearance of your granite countertops through regular cleaning and sealing. Use a pH-neutral cleaner and a soft cloth to clean the surface, avoiding abrasive pads and harsh chemicals. Regularly sealing the granite helps maintain its resistance to stains and moisture, preserving the smooth finish. Follow the manufacturer’s recommendations for sealing frequency based on the finish you choose.
